Transaction e8ef94384d21cebc85e2ab3a1f3df9afe1922365bd31676a002c6e1fd41a54b1
1 Input
1 Output
-
e8ef94384d21cebc85e2ab3a1f3df9afe1922365bd31676a002c6e1fd41a54b1:0
- value
- 25508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f40ce6b6894c96f6bdb1734599d877defd212d9 OP_EQUAL
- address
- 35zsKP8Fhxg2fNwePepUdrYuSDGLQcDFae